The Rise of Agentic AI: Building Self-Directed Digital Workforces

Artificial Intelligence has progressed far beyond systems that simply answer questions or generate content. A new generation of intelligent software, known as Agentic AI, is redefining how organizations operate by enabling digital systems to perceive, reason, plan, and execute tasks with minimal human intervention. Unlike conventional AI tools that wait for instructions, Agentic AI continuously evaluates situations, makes informed decisions, and adapts its actions to achieve predefined objectives.

This evolution marks the beginning of self-directed digital workforces. Rather than replacing employees, these intelligent agents act as collaborative partners capable of handling repetitive, analytical, and operational responsibilities. They can monitor business processes, coordinate across applications, identify anomalies, generate reports, schedule workflows, and even interact with customers while learning from experience.

The healthcare sector offers a compelling example of Agentic AI in action. Intelligent agents can monitor patient records, prioritise clinical alerts, automate appointment scheduling, optimise resource allocation, and assist medical professionals by summarising patient histories. These capabilities reduce administrative burden, allowing clinicians to devote more time to patient care. Similarly, in banking, autonomous AI agents strengthen fraud detection by continuously monitoring transaction patterns and responding to suspicious activities in real time.

Manufacturing, logistics, retail, and cybersecurity are also embracing Agentic AI. Smart digital agents optimise inventory, predict equipment failures, coordinate supply chains, and detect evolving cyber threats without requiring continuous human oversight. As organizations face increasing operational complexity, these intelligent systems provide faster decision-making, improved efficiency, and greater resilience.

Despite its transformative potential, Agentic AI introduces important governance challenges. Autonomous decision-making requires transparency, accountability, and robust security controls. Organisations must establish clear policies that define the responsibilities, permissions, and monitoring mechanisms for AI agents. Human oversight remains essential, particularly in high-impact domains such as healthcare, finance, and public services, where ethical considerations and regulatory compliance cannot be delegated entirely to machines.

Another critical factor is trust. Employees must understand how AI agents reach decisions and when human intervention is required. Explainable AI, strong cybersecurity practices, and continuous performance monitoring are therefore fundamental to successful deployment. Responsible implementation ensures that Agentic AI becomes a reliable collaborator rather than an unpredictable automation tool.

Looking ahead, digital workforces will likely consist of teams where humans and autonomous AI agents work together seamlessly. Human expertise will remain indispensable for creativity, empathy, strategic thinking, and ethical judgment, while AI agents manage data-intensive and repetitive operations at unprecedented speed and scale. Organizations that invest in responsible AI governance, workforce upskilling, and secure digital infrastructure today will be better positioned to thrive in this new era of intelligent automation.

The rise of Agentic AI represents more than another technological milestone, it signals a fundamental shift in the future of work. Businesses that embrace self-directed digital workforces responsibly will unlock higher productivity, smarter decision-making, and greater innovation while empowering people to focus on solving the complex challenges that truly require human intelligence.
